Cantata for the Revolution

The morning turned musical in the city of Morón, with a Cantata dedicated to the 66th anniversary of the Revolution, where amateur voices performed applauded melodies.

It was José Ramón who opened the Cantata with a piece that won first place in the recently celebrated Silencio Azul Music Creator’s Festival, entitled Me haces Falta.

The young Harold Braw, set the activity area in motion with the well liked interpretation of La Flaca, a number with which he has garnered much applause in his short career in musical interpretation.

Other fans of the municipality climbed the stage, where lively cultural activities have been taking place since January 1st of the new year (Author: Loenel Iparraguirre González).
